The lifts were in a pack of 1/64 scale cars called M2 Machines. You could get them at WalMart and other places for a while in a 2 car pack or the pack I bought had one car and 5 lifts. One was a base and 4 stacks. Kinda lame as it leaves a lift out for what we use them for I need another one B) These work great for workbench stuff like separating your body/chassis/windows. I do not think anyone has them anymore buy maybe Ebay. Hope it helps B)
